Types of Expo Banners

Expo banners come in diverse types. They include:

  • Vinyl Banners

    Conventionally, vinyl banners are popularized by their durability, being retardant to water, wind, and sun. They delineate bright and sharp graphics and are adapted for adventitious use, hence fitting indoors and outside. Frequently, these banners are fabricated from heavy-duty vinyl, hence ensuring that they withstand weather elements. Also, they are exceptional to be utilized for prolonged events or outdoor expos due to their durability and visibility from afar.

  • Retractable Banners

    Pull banners, sometimes coined as pop up banners, are manufactured for convenience and portability. These are usually banners attached to a retractable stand, which is ingeniously housed in a case constructed to be portable. These banners are expeditiously set up and taken down, making them ideal for expos and trade shows where agility is indispensable. Also, statement banners are occasionally utilized as background settings for pictures.

  • Fabric Banners

    Fabric banners are conventionally developed from polyester or a similar fabric. Normally, they offer an upscale look, as well as feel, compared to vinyl. These are conventionally lightweight and resplendent, and they are delineated for easy transportation and storage. Mostly, fabric banners are preferred for their aesthetic properties, which adapt them to expos where corporate image and branding represent key priorities.

  • Mesh Banners

    These banners are habitually fabricated from perforated vinyl. Thus, it allows wind to pass through, which minimizes the risk of banners tearing down or being swept away during inclement weather. Normally, they are outstanding for open-air events, particularly in areas susceptible to windy conditions. In addition, they still maintain visibility and are adapted for outdoor advertising.

  • Banner Stands

    Conventionally, banner stands are manufacturers' favorites due to their reusability and practicality in diverse events. Also, they come in divergent designs, including collapsible and adjustable heights. Often these stands are fitted with interchangeable banner frames, thus enabling users to exhibit variegated graphics without necessitating entire banner replacements. Usually, they are perfect for businesses requiring flexibility in displaying divergent messages.

Expo Banner Durability

The durability of printed banners is vital for their effectiveness during events. This is because it determines how well they will withstand varying elements in adverse weather conditions, prolonged use, and transportations, amongst others. Often, the materials from which banners are manufactured, alongside their design features, significantly influence durability. Key aspects include the following:

  • Banner Material Composition

    Usually, banners are fabricated from disparate materials, each with its unique endurance properties. Ideally, vinyl is the most prevalent material on account of its resilience. Normally, 13 oz. vinyl is used in the preparation of banners, which balance between flexibility and toughness. Further, fabric banners, although lighter and often embodying premium aesthetic value, are more vulnerable to tearing. This makes them unsuitable at outdoor events, especially when wands are a possibility.

  • Weather Resistance

    Customarily, banners adapted for outdoor applications are retardant to weather elements. Normally, they are fabricated with UV-resistant inks to prevent fading from prolonged exposure to sunlight. Normally, mesh banners are designed to allow wind to pass through, thus reducing the probability of damage in windy conditions. Also, the waterproofing of vinyl is done to keep the print quality intact in case of rain.

  • Printing Technology and Peeling

    Usually, the longevity of the banner depends significantly on the printing method used. Often, digital printing is the most favored technique for banners on account of its capacity to yield vibrant and long-lasting images. Conventionally, this method enables the printing of weather-resistant inks that adhere tightly to the banner material. Also, conventional printing prevents peeling, which affects banner quality.

  • Reinforcement and Edges

    Normal practices such as reinforcing edges with hems or stitched borders usually enhance a banner's durability. These reinforcements minimize fraying and tearing at the edges, which is a common occurrence after prolonged use or heavy winds. Also, the insertion of grommets further aids in protecting key suspension points from tearing, thus ensuring that the banner hangs strongly and securely.

  • Transportation and Storage

    Conventionally, most banners are purposely created with durability for easy transportation and storage. Customarily, collapsible banner stands and carrying cases enable the safe transport of banners with minimal risk of damage. Normal storage solutions reduce the banners' exposure to adverse elements, thus prolonging their lifespan when not in use.

How to Choose Expo Banners

When selecting customized banners for expos, there are various factors business owners should consider to ensure they effectively promote their brand. They include:

  • Purpose

    Depending on the function, buyers will select different banners. For instance, they will choose custom-made banners for branding or as announcements. Buyers should also give banners that can be modified to display variable information like sale messages or product details.

  • Size

    Buyers should ensure the size of the selected banners will fit the available space at the expo venue. They should also get the standard sizes available. This is because, in some situations, the venue's configuration may not support the ideal corporate image. More importantly, buyers should get functional hardware to match the available space.

  • Material

    Banners are manufactured from diverse materials, each encapsulating its unique advantages. For instance, vinyl is stellar for outdoor usage on account of its resilience to all weather elements. Usually, fabric banners create a premium feel and are adapted for indoor settings. Moreover, mesh banners possess the exceptional ability to emulate wind passage, thus minimizing potential blowing or tearing amid outdoor festivities.

  • Design and Message

    Buyers should ensure the banner increments has easy-to-read texts and high-contrast color combinations. They should also make sure the banner displays a strong company value proposition. The design should also be easy to fold to facilitate transport and storage.

  • Budget

    Buyers will encounter various banners at different prices. Likewise, hardware, customization level, and material configuration are crucial price determinants. Business owners should also consider the printing method as it will affect the total cost. For instance, digital printing is trendy. However, it is costlier than traditional printing. Economy shoppers should consider bulk purchases to help them save on finances.

  • Customization Options

    Numerous sellers present such diverse customization degrees as graphic designs and banner sizes. Banners boasting bespoke designs are effective in mirroring the unique branding of a particular business. For purposes of achieving coherence in branding, buyers should collaborate with professional designers to create bespoke graphics for the banners.

  • Installation and Display

    Buyers need to consider how the banner will be installed. Will it be hung, tied, or will there be a standalone display? They should also get accessories like stands and clips.

  • Portability and Storage

    Occasionally, businesses participate in several expos within a given season. Thus, in such instances, portability remains a key consideration when purchasing a banner. Normally, collapsible stands and light materials enable effortless transportation. Further, practical storage solutions guarantee the longevity of these banners and their continued effectiveness across different events.

Q&A

Which hardware configuration works best for a free hanging banner?

The best hardware solution for a free-hanging expo banner is a rod pocket with a weighted bottom. The bottom weight helps keep the banner straight and flat, providing a clear view of the message. In addition, a rod pocket allows easy sliding of the banner along a curtain rod or dowel for quick setup and adjustments.

Will less glaring prints affect the quality of the photo printed on the banner?

Photo quality depends on the printing technique used on the banner material. Opt for banners with less glare to avoid reflection that can obscure the photo. In photo printing focus, use of cutting edge printing technology like digital printing enhances quality by affixing detailed images even on non-glossy surfaces.

Which is better between fabric and vinyl banners for outdoor expos?

Vinyl banners are often better for outdoor use due to their durability and weather resistance. They can withstand wind, rain, and sun exposure without fading or tearing. Fabric banners can be used outdoors but are more suitable for indoor settings; they offer a more upscale appearance.

What is the eco-friendliness level of trade show banners?

Trade show banners can be eco-friendly options, especially those made from recyclable materials like fabric or recyclable vinyl. Many producers now offer eco-friendly inks and materials, reducing their environmental impact. Selection of eco-friendly banner materials contributes to sustainable practices without compromising branding activities.
